The drop for Sange is easiest in Skyly or Yellowboze, from same monster (Cave Mil Lily) at same drop rate (1/2), it's an easy find.
The drop for Yasha is, like Mimas said, 1/28808 for Skyly Temple Dark Belra, an incredibly tough drop, but if you're online, do the quest Famitsu Maximum Attack 2, there are a lot of Belras and very quickly (from 5 to 10 minutes depending on your Lv, loading times excluded).
It's clearly the best way to get Yasha, but it's not very rewarding until you actually get it, provided you do.

The drop for Yasha for Viridia, the only other ID that gets it, is 1/67217 off a Melqueek, a drop many consider impossible, and for a reason, lol.
Online quest Lost Ice Spinner has 125 Melqueeks, which is not bad, but it's still tougher than the Skyly way...
On the bright side, Viridia Caves has many good drops that will drop along the way: God/Power, God/Body, Final Impact, Sange, Red Partisan, Red Sword.
